The extent of your responsibilities will include but is not limited to: • Plan and execute the daily forecast and effective materials management of all non-inventory packaging supplies • Execute purchase order creation • Liaise with suppliers to secure prompt deliveries • Develop relationships with primary internal customers (on-site management teams), external suppliers and other Amazon Teams (Operations and Corporate) • Work in full compliance with the company Spending and Transaction Policy • Plan truck deliveries in full • Plan time slots for deliveries upfront with the suppliers • Communicate the accurate delivery schedule to the local FC materials receiving teams • Be the escalation POC to ensure deliveries are offloaded as per the agreed timelines with suppliers • Work with Operations and on site procurement teams to define strategies to mitigate space constraints • Manage and drive down the number of Invoices on Hold (IOH) requests • Provide support to other buyers in other regions as and when required • Provide training to new buyers • Deliver Procurement metrics in line with set targets. This includes achieving KPI metrics, cost savings for the cluster, no FC stock-out issues and achieving individual project objectives. • Perform compliance checks on purchase requisitions • Create, modify or deprecate procurement catalogs • Perform Vendor Onboarding tasks BASIC QUALIFICATIONS - Knowledge of advanced English at CEFR level B2/C1 - Experience with MS Office, in particular MS Excel P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S - Experience in procurement and purchasing, including supplier relationship management - Speak, write, and read fluently in Italian - Speak, write, and read fluently in Japanese - Speak, write, and read fluently in German - Speak, write, and read fluently in Arabic
